Materials and Preparing Your Fabric
Before beginning your Standing Strong Quilt Pattern, gather all the essential quilting supplies. You’ll need quilting cotton fabrics, coordinating thread, a rotary cutter, quilting ruler, cutting mat, sewing machine, pins or clips, and a quality iron.
High-quality quilting cotton is the preferred fabric because it offers excellent stability, crisp pressing, and long-lasting durability. Selecting fabrics with strong contrast helps define the geometric shapes and enhances the finished design.
Accurate cutting is one of the most important aspects of successful quilting. Carefully measure every square, rectangle, and triangle before cutting to ensure each piece fits together precisely during assembly.
Organize your fabric pieces according to color and size before sewing. Arranging everything in advance allows you to verify placement, balance colors, and reduce the chance of assembly errors.
Maintain a consistent quarter-inch seam allowance throughout the project. Uniform seam allowances ensure the finished blocks measure correctly and fit together smoothly when constructing the quilt top.
Finally, press every seam carefully as you work. Proper pressing improves accuracy, reduces bulk, and gives your Standing Strong Quilt Pattern a clean, polished appearance from beginning to end.
Step-by-Step Block Construction
Begin your Standing Strong Quilt Pattern by assembling the smallest patchwork units first. Depending on your chosen version, these may include half-square triangles, strip sets, or simple square combinations that form the foundation of the design.
After completing these individual units, arrange them on a flat surface according to the pattern layout. Reviewing the arrangement before sewing helps confirm proper placement and allows you to make adjustments if necessary.
Sew neighboring pieces together using an accurate quarter-inch seam allowance. Press each seam before continuing to the next section, keeping the fabric flat and maintaining the block’s precise dimensions.
As larger sections come together, the distinctive geometry of the Standing Strong Quilt Pattern becomes increasingly visible. Watching the design develop is one of the most satisfying parts of the quilting process.
Continue joining rows and larger units carefully, paying close attention to matching seam intersections. Accurate alignment creates crisp lines and enhances the professional appearance of the finished quilt.
After assembling the complete block, give it a final press and trim only if necessary. Your finished block is now ready to be combined with additional blocks into a beautiful quilt top.
Creative Layout Ideas and Finishing Touches
One of the greatest strengths of the Standing Strong Quilt Pattern is its adaptability. Rotating blocks or experimenting with color placement can produce striking secondary designs across the finished quilt.
A high-contrast color palette creates bold visual movement, while monochromatic fabrics offer a calm, elegant appearance. Both approaches showcase the pattern’s geometric beauty in different ways.
Scrappy versions are another wonderful option. Combining leftover fabrics introduces texture, personality, and unique color combinations while making excellent use of fabric remnants from previous quilting projects.
Seasonal fabrics also work beautifully with this design. Floral collections create fresh spring quilts, rich autumn tones provide warmth, and festive holiday prints transform the pattern into seasonal home décor.
After piecing the quilt top, choose quilting motifs that complement rather than overwhelm the patchwork. Straight-line quilting highlights the geometric design, while gentle curves or loops add texture and softness.
Complete your project with a coordinating border and carefully selected binding. These finishing details frame the Standing Strong Quilt Pattern beautifully and give your handmade quilt a refined, professional finish.
